Lisa has drawn intense criticism on Met Monday after walking the red carpet in an embroidered bodysuit that seemingly depicts impactful Black leaders throughout history—including a figure who looks a lot like Rosa Parks.
“Rosa Parks underwear” began trending during the Met Gala on Monday evening after the Blackpink star walked the red carpet.
Here is a closer look at Lisa’s outfit:
Fans are taking to X to express their disappointment, noting that depicting Rosa Parks’ face on a pair of underwear is disrespectful and in poor taste.
